From October 7 of that year until February 12 of this year, the army killed 962 men and 45 women from the sports sector in the coastal enclave, the PFA detailed in a report published here.
The total includes players, coaches, administrators, referees, presidents and board members, as well as staff working in sports federations and institutions.
The report indicated that the Palestinian Authority (PFA) suffered the highest number of fatalities with 565, followed by various Olympic federations with 317, and the Palestinian Association of Scouts and Guides with 125.
The report detailed that Israeli attacks destroyed 184 sports facilities, including stadiums, courts, halls, and administrative headquarters; 81 were partially demolished, and another 265 were damaged.
Some of the main stadiums, such as Yarmouk, Palestine, and Al-Durra, were converted into shelters for displaced people, it noted.
